What Is Vacation Rental Consulting?

Vacation rental consulting is professional guidance designed to help property owners optimize their short-term rentals. Think of it as having an experienced advisor in your corner. A consultant helps you understand what is working, what is not, and how to close the gap.

Good consulting covers a wide range of topics. For example, it might include pricing strategy, listing optimization, guest experience design, and operational efficiency. Because of this, owners often see measurable improvements in both occupancy and guest satisfaction after working with a qualified team.

Why Cave Creek Property Owners Need Expert Guidance

Cave Creek is a unique market. It sits at the northern edge of the Phoenix metro area, attracting a mix of outdoor adventurers, snowbirds, and luxury travelers. As a result, the right pricing strategy here looks very different from what works in Tempe or Glendale.

Local knowledge matters. A consultant who understands Cave Creek seasonal demand, nearby events, and traveler expectations will help you position your property far more effectively than a generic approach ever could. Furthermore, local insight helps you anticipate slow periods and plan accordingly.

Pricing and Revenue Strategy

Dynamic pricing is one of the most powerful tools in short-term rental management. Instead of setting a flat nightly rate, dynamic pricing adjusts based on demand, seasonality, local events, and competitor availability. Many owners leave significant revenue on the table by skipping this step.

A consulting team can review your current rates, benchmark them against comparable Cave Creek properties, and recommend a smarter pricing structure. Additionally, they can provide revenue estimates so you have a realistic picture of your property’s earning potential before making big decisions.

Listing Optimization

Your listing is your first impression. On platforms like Airbnb and Vrbo, guests scroll quickly. Strong photos, a compelling title, and a well-written description all influence whether someone clicks — or keeps scrolling.

Consulting support often includes a full listing audit. This covers photo quality, headline clarity, amenity descriptions, and how your property compares to similar rentals in the Cave Creek area. Small changes here can lead to meaningful improvements in both click-through rates and bookings.

Guest Experience Design

Modern travelers expect more than a clean space. They want a seamless, hotel-quality experience inside a comfortable home. That means clear check-in instructions, well-stocked kitchens, fresh linens, quality bath amenities, and fast responses to any questions.

A good consultant will walk through your entire guest journey — from the first booking confirmation to the post-stay review request. Moreover, they will identify gaps that might be quietly hurting your review scores without you realizing it.

Full-Service Management vs. Consulting: What Is the Difference?

Some property owners want hands-on help with every aspect of their rental. Others prefer to stay involved but want expert input to guide their decisions. Both approaches are valid, and understanding the difference helps you choose the right path.

Vacation rental consulting typically means working with an expert to improve your strategy and operations — while you continue to manage day-to-day tasks yourself. It is a collaborative model that works well for experienced owners who want a fresh perspective.

Full-service property management, on the other hand, hands off everything. A management team handles pricing, guest communication, cleaning, maintenance coordination, listing management, and more. For many Cave Creek owners, especially those who live outside Arizona or have multiple properties, full-service management is the more practical choice.

Signs You Could Benefit from Vacation Rental Consulting

Not sure if consulting is right for you? Here are some common signs that professional guidance could make a real difference for your Cave Creek rental.

  • Your occupancy rate is inconsistent. Strong months followed by long stretches of vacancies often signal a pricing or listing problem.
  • Your reviews mention the same issues repeatedly. Guest feedback is valuable data. If the same complaint keeps appearing, it is worth addressing strategically.
  • You feel overwhelmed by the day-to-day. Managing a short-term rental can consume more time than expected. A consultant can help you build systems that run more smoothly.
  • You are not sure what your property is worth on the market. Without a clear revenue benchmark, it is hard to know whether your rental is performing well or leaving money behind.
  • You are preparing to launch a new rental. Getting the setup right from day one is far easier than fixing problems after bad reviews start rolling in.

What to Look for in a Vacation Rental Consultant

The consulting space has grown quickly alongside the short-term rental industry. That means there are plenty of options — but not all of them are equally qualified. Here is what to prioritize when evaluating a consultant or management team for your Cave Creek property.

Local Market Knowledge

First, look for someone who knows the Arizona market specifically. A consultant based in another state may understand short-term rentals in general, but they will not know the seasonal quirks of the Sonoran Desert, the impact of spring training season, or why Cave Creek demand spikes during certain months.

Transparent Processes and Communication

Next, ask how they communicate with property owners. Good consultants and management companies are upfront about what they do, how often they report, and what results to realistically expect. Be cautious of anyone who makes bold guarantees about income — responsible professionals present honest estimates, not promises.

A Track Record with Real Properties

Finally, look for experience with properties similar to yours. A team that manages luxury homes, casitas, and urban condos across the Phoenix metro will have practical knowledge that translates directly to your Cave Creek rental.
